Advanced Excel
VBA Training
Focus
|
The capability exists within Microsoft Excel and VBA to construct
complex dashboard driven analysis and data processing business tools.
These business tools can go far beyond simple macros becoming
actual applications. Excel has a vast array of
automated features like graphics, ActiveX controls, worksheets, userforms
and cell ranges that when combined together allow these
dashboard driven programs to be created.
When you tie other programs and computer languages to Excel
through VBA like Word, PowerPoint, Access, SQL Server, Lotus
Notes, C and VB .Net, Excel VBA can tap into these environments obtaining
the functionality it does not have. This workshop focuses on
using all of these elements to construct sophisticated data
processing and analysis programs in Microsoft Excel.
|
What You Learn at a Glance |
-
What
is VBA?
-
An advanced review of the
Excel VBA language
-
Advanced VBA data processing
techniques for multi worksheets and multi workbooks
-
Advanced summary worksheet
construction in Excel using Excel VBA
-
Advanced techniques for scanning Windows folders for workbooks and then
opening them using VBA
-
How to read text files using
VBA.
-
Advanced VBA programming
techniques for creating multiple charts from multiple data sheets
-
How to create advanced
business user interfaces on worksheets using ActiveX controls, VBA and
graphics
-
Advanced
excel dashboard
construction
-
How to create and use
userforms in VBA (wizards)
-
How to create event driven
programs using VBA
-
Advanced VBA error protection
techniques
-
How to create custom
toolbars and menus to run your VBA code
-
How to communicate with
databases using DAO and ADO in VBA and how to download data from the web
using VBA
-
Advanced VBA techniques for
communicating with other languages and programs
-
3-day workshop
-
Personal
examples: Covered
in-class
-
Excel Versions:
2000-2007
-
Type: Business
Professionals
-
Platform: Windows
-
Training Materials:
Included, 1600+ page manual including our Excel
Add-Ins
-
Training Method: Hands-on
|
Workshop Outline and Self-Study
Manual Content |
In this advanced Microsoft Excel VBA 3-day "hands-on"
business workshop or self-study manual, you will learn:
Day-1
-
Microsoft Excel VBA language overview
-
Advanced techniques for scanning Windows
folders for workbooks and then opening them using VBA
-
How to read text files
using VBA.
-
Advanced VBA
data entry, data
processing and data summation techniques for multi worksheet and multi workbook
problems
-
Advanced
techniques to reconcile data in Excel using Excel VBA
-
Advanced VBA programming
techniques for creating multiple charts from multiple data sheets
-
How to control drawing
shapes, ActiveX controls and Excel's coordinate system with VBA
(Worksheet Form Construction)
-
How to
create VBA events for action driven applications in Microsoft Excel
Day-2
-
How to develop business user
interfaces on the worksheet using ActiveX controls and Excel VBA
-
VBA wizard overview
-
Overview of using
userforms to create business wizards
-
How to create
userforms in VBA
-
How to create
controls and graphics on userforms
-
How to command
userforms and their ActiveX controls with VBA
-
Excel VBA wizard design
tips
-
How to create toolbars
and menus to control your VBA wizards
-
How to control
Excel’s toolbar and menu system with VBA
Day-3
-
How to use graphics,
userforms, drawing shapes, ActiveX controls and Excel VBA to create
advanced dashboards in Excel
-
Advanced command
of Microsoft Word and PowerPoint using Excel VBA (report
generation tools)
-
How to command databases
using DAO and ADO in VBA and how to download data from the web using
VBA
-
How to distribute your
Excel programs
-
How to control other
languages like Perl and C
|
Training Options, Schedule,
Enrollment and Self-Study |

|
EMAGENIT's Training Location |
Hotel: Thousand Oaks
Inn
EMAGENIT is based in Thousand Oaks,
CA which is in the vicinity of Los Angeles county (LA County), Ventura
county, Santa Barbara county and San Diego county. We hold all of our courses
on-site nation wide.
We also webcast (webinar) our public workshops, consult our
webcast page for more information.
Our public workshops are a short commute for those living in:
-
Los Angeles, CA
-
Palmdale, CA
-
Westwood, CA
-
Santa
Barbara, CA
-
San
Fernando Valley, CA
-
Santa Clarita,
CA
-
Newbury Park, CA
-
Westlake
Village, CA
-
Camarillo, CA
-
Calabasas,
CA
-
Sherman Oaks, CA
|
-
Reseda, CA
-
Woodland Hills,
CA
-
Hollywood, CA
-
Fillmore, CA
-
Ventura, CA
-
Moorpark, CA
-
Simi Valley, CA
-
Santa Monica, CA
-
Oxnard, CA
-
Pasadena, CA
-
Agoura, CA
|
For more information about our public workshops,
visit our public workshops page our call us at
805.498.7162.
Submit a question to us via email at
advancedvba@emagenit.com
Call EMAGENIT between the hours of 8:00 A.M. and 5 P.M. PST at
1.805.498.7162 or 805.558.9277 for more information about this
workshop.
|
|
EMAGENIT
NASA Award for Excel |
 |
|
EMAGENIT received an
award for its involvement with NASA JPL in helping
redesign and integrate their conceptual Rover
mission software in Microsoft Excel. Click the
picture above for more detail about our Rover
involvement. To learn more about the NASA mission to
mars
click here. |
|
Awards &
Customers |
Typical Workshop
Examples

Advanced Summary Workbook
Construction, Data Processing and Windows
Folder/File Access Using VBA

Advanced Multi Chart
Construction, Microsoft PowerPoint Control and
Microsoft Word Control Using VBA

Advanced VBA Techniques for
Downloading Data from the Web and Databases

Advanced Worksheet Form
Construction Using ActiveX Controls, Worksheets
and Shapes

Advanced Dashboard
Construction Using Userforms, Shapes, Worksheets
and ActiveX Controls
|